In an arithmetic series, the value of the nth term is calculated using the equation,
an = ao + (n - 1)(d)
where an and ao are the nth and the 1st term, respectively. d is the common difference, and n is the number of terms.
In the given, an = 48, a0 = 93, d = -5 and n is unknown. Substituting the known values,
48 = 93 + (n - 1)(-5)
The value of n from the equation is 10. Thus, the answer is the last choice.

If b is the rate of the boat, and s is the rate of the stream, then:
b − s = 4
b + s = 10
Solve the system of equations with substitution or elimination. Using elimination, add the equations together:
2b = 14
b = 7
The boat's rate is 7 mph.
